If the IRS rejects your Form 990 filing, you can easily fix the issues and e-file an updated return through TaxZerone for free. Here’s how:
- Sign in to your TaxZerone account and navigate to the Exempt Organization Forms Dashboard.
- Locate the rejected Form 990 return.
- Click the “Fix Errors” button next to the rejected return.
- Update the Form 990 based on the reason the IRS rejected it. Make sure to correct any errors or add any missing information.
- Re-submit the revised Form 990 return.
